Cooling Kernersville, NC, Homes Through Humid Triad Summers

Humidity changes how indoor comfort feels. Even when an air conditioner lowers the temperature, excess moisture can leave rooms sticky and encourage longer thermostat adjustments.

A properly operating system should complete cooling cycles long enough to remove heat and moisture. If cycles end too quickly, the home may cool near the thermostat without gaining balanced comfort elsewhere.

Temperature and Humidity Problems that Require AC Repair

AC repair may be necessary when homeowners notice cool but damp rooms, uneven temperatures, or repeated system starts. The technician should consider both the equipment and the conditions inside the home.

Signs that deserve attention include:

  • The AC starts and stops every few minutes.
  • Indoor air feels humid despite a low thermostat setting.
  • Some rooms cool much faster than others.
  • The system produces weak airflow.
  • Water appears near the indoor equipment.
  • The outdoor unit shuts down unexpectedly.
  • Summer electricity use rises without a change in schedule.

Incorrect cooling settings can also lead to inconsistent performance. A thermostat placed in the wrong mode, programmed for frequent setbacks, or set to operate the fan continuously may affect moisture control.

Thermostat service can confirm whether schedules, settings, wiring, and temperature readings are accurate. However, control changes cannot correct failing components, restricted airflow, or poorly matched equipment.
